Hole In The Sky (1995)
Rating:
Starring: Sam Elliot, Ricky Jay, Jerry O'Connel
Director: John Kent Harrison
Category: Action / Adventure, Western
Studio: Pioneer Studios
Subtitles:
[None]
Length:
94 mins

 
 

 

The Place Where Legends Are Made

Acclaimed author Norman Maclean returns to the Montana wilds he made famous in A River Runs Through It with this exhilarating, rough-and-ready tale of adventure, action and romance.

The year is 1919. Amid the spectacular beauty and danger of the remote Montana wilderness, young Mac (Jerry O'Connell) challenges the elements - and his own inner resources - to realize his dream of becoming a high-country ranger. In spite of the powerful bond he shares with his idol and mentor, legendary ranger Bill Bell (Sam Elliott), Mac's hot temper and headstrong ways constantly land him in trouble. Tensions rise even higher at the ranger's mountain camp when the new cook (Ricky Jay) replaces Mac as Bell's latest "fair-haired boy." But when Bill calls on Mac to help him and the cook take revenge on a band of villainous card sharks infesting a nearby town, Mac is caught up in an outrageous, potentially deadly scheme!
